William Wilder, BSW, CADC
Chief Marketing Officer
William has been with our organization since 2015 and has over 15 years of experience in the behavioral health field. As Chief Marketing Officer he plans, develops, implements, and oversees Aliya Health Group’s overall business strategy, working as part of the C-suite team to best position our organization for growth. William also coaches and mentors our business development teams across the U.S., helping them reach their goals and full potential. William earned a bachelor’s degree in social work from Rutgers University-Newark. He is a certified drug and alcohol counselor (CADC), a certified recovery coach (CCAR), and holds a leadership certification from the National Association of Social Workers (NASW). Prior to joining Aliya Health Group, William worked in counseling and supervisory roles for organizations that provided behavioral health services to adolescents and adults with substance use disorders and women released from incarceration.
William was drawn to this work because he wanted to be a voice for people struggling with addiction and make a difference in their lives. Witnessing the gift of life return to clients and building teams of people he knows to make a positive impact are what he finds most rewarding about his job.
